## Deployment

The Addrly autocomplete widget deploys as a static bundle plus a lookup API. Build the bundle with the standard pipeline, push to the CDN bucket, then restart the lookup service. Staging and prod use separate geocode datasets, so always deploy staging first. The lookup service starts with the following configuration.

config for yagag-baduf:
DRUAEL_LOG_LEVEL=debug
DRUAEL_METRICS_HOST=metrics.druael.zemvarworks.corp
DRUAEL_POOL_SIZE=16

Ticket: Hollyfork loyalty-points ledger double-credits on retried checkout. When the Bramblewise gateway times out and retries, the ledger writes two credit rows because idempotency keys aren't checked on the points path. Customers are noticing. Fix is small — add the key check in the ledger writer — but we need it in the next cut. The offending build is tagged below.

build token for hafop-fawif: htk31_9758d5e565aa3b14f55d629377373c4

## Configuration

Welcome aboard! Hatchline replaces our old hand-rolled job queue (RIP, cron-and-hope). Copy env.sample to .env, set HATCHLINE_CONCURRENCY to something sane like 4, and leave the retry backoff defaults alone unless you enjoy pager noise. Workers won't boot without the broker connection settings filled in. One more thing: the broker requires an access credential, and it lives on the next line of your .env.

vault entry, kagep-yajeg: COURIER_KEY5=da097

Hey Priya — handing over the Quillbase static-analysis setup. Heads up: the baseline file (`sa-baseline.yml`) suppresses about 140 legacy findings so new PRs stay clean. Don't let anyone add fresh suppressions without a ticket — that's the whole game. I've been burning down roughly ten entries a sprint. The suppression policy and the burn-down tracker are on the page below.

runbook for fajep-yahop: https://rundeck.braskdata.example/repo/run/pages/job/dfe5b8c563356906

FAQ — Why did Lanternquery slow down last sprint?

The planner regression in Lanternquery 4.2 caused certain joins on the Fennwick cluster to pick nested loops over hash joins when statistics were stale, inflating p95 by roughly 6x. We reverted the cost-model change and added a stats-freshness check to CI. Discuss remaining edge cases at the weekly eng sync. To reproduce the regression locally, you need access to the frozen stats snapshot; the archive unlocks with the recovery passphrase below.

unlock words, yadup-yagef: zorael-druix